Reflected Cross-Site Scripting Vulnerability in Subitem AL Slider by WordPress
CVE-2026-1634
6.1MEDIUM
What is CVE-2026-1634?
The Subitem AL Slider plugin for WordPress exhibits a vulnerability that allows reflected cross-site scripting through the $_SERVER['PHP_SELF'] parameter. This issue arises from inadequate input sanitization and output escaping mechanisms. Consequently, unauthenticated attackers can exploit this flaw to inject malicious scripts into pages, potentially leading to unauthorized actions if users are lured into clicking a crafty link.
